A Clear Overview of Digital Print Films: Applications and Options

An Introduction to Digital Print Films


Digital print films are adaptable materials created to accept printed graphics using modern print systems. Typical uses include signage, marketing displays, interior décor and branding applications. A standard film features a printable top layer and an adhesive backing, allowing application to surfaces such as glass, walls, vehicles and panels.


These films are developed to deliver consistent print quality, strong colour definition and durability. Whether used for short-term promotions or long-term installations, they provide a practical solution for producing impactful visuals.



Different Types of Digital Printing Film


Monomeric film is suited to short-term use. It is an affordable option ideal for flat indoor surfaces. Retail displays and temporary signage often rely on this type because of its simplicity and affordability.



Polymeric films provide greater durability and dimensional stability than monomeric options. They are suitable for medium-term use and can conform to slight curves. They are commonly chosen for window graphics and everyday signage applications.



Cast digital print films are designed for more complex and demanding uses. Their flexibility allows them to wrap around curves, rivets and contours. They are commonly used for vehicle wraps and long-term outdoor installations due to their durability.

Important Features to Review


Not all films work with every printing method. It is important to select films suitable for solvent, eco-solvent, UV or latex printing processes.



Adhesive type influences both application and removal. Options include permanent, removable and repositionable adhesives depending on the project needs.



Finishes such as gloss, matt and satin affect the final appearance. Gloss enhances colour vibrancy, while matt reduces glare for a softer look.



For outdoor applications, UV protection and weather resistance are important. Indoor settings can use lighter films with shorter expected durability.
